Description
English: Title: Attorney General Alexander Mitchell Palmer, half-length portrait, standing, facing slightly right; seen through the window of his home at 2132 R. Street, N.W., Washington, D.C., after it was bombed on June 2, 1919 Abstract/medium: 1 photograph : print ; photo 16 x 11 cm, mount 28 x 36 cm.
Date
Source

Library of Congress

Author Harris & Ewing, photographer
